Former candidate indicted for sexual battery against minor
A former Republican primary candidate for the U.S. House of Representatives and Pikeville resident Randy Sharp was indicted for sexual battery against a minor by the Bledsoe County Grand Jury on Monday, November 22.
Sharp, 57, was indicted for aggravated sexual battery against a child under the age of 13. According to court records, the offending activity occurred between May 1, 2019 and November 30, 2019.
Sharp ran unsuccessfully in the Republican primary against U.S. Representative Scott DesJarlais in August 2020, after the offending activities allegedly occurred.
He bonded out in the amount of $50,000 and his next court date is December 13.
